In regards to money, seems like Ryback is arguing for something similar to a real league minimum done in sports. Not just everyone gets an equal amount for a base salary but everything the WWE makes wrestlers cover on their own is included.
For some comparisons, NXT base salaries are around the $25k range but WWE covers everything to ensure its a comfortable amount. On the main roster, the base salary is a lot larger but huge chunks are eaten away by travel, room, and food expenses since the WWE covers very little. Hurts the lower tier wrestlers a lot more than the upper mid and top tier stars. Combine that with house shows and merch being the bulk of money earned by most wrestlers, makes sense why someone like a Ryback or an Adam Rose would be upset whenever things that are hurting their potential money if happening. Rose lashed out because his punishment is taking away valuable house show money while Ryback lashed out because his merch sales have been dropping while the WWE has been devaluing his potential star value. |
